首页 > 其他 > 详细

zip函数

时间:2020-03-22 16:58:26      阅读:54      评论:0      收藏:0      [点我收藏+]

1.对两个列表中的元素一一对应,创建成一个字典

a = [1,2,3]
b = ["a","b","c"]

print(list(zip (b,a)))


>>>>{"a":1,"b":2,"c":3}

2.对多个列表中的每个元素进行赋值,即先将第一个列表中的第一个元素取出来,再取出第二个列表的第一个元素,直到所有列表取完,再从头取第一个列表第二个元素

注意:所有列表的长度必须相同

a = [1,2,3]
b = [4,5,6]
c = [7,8,9]

for value in zip(a,b,c):
    k,l,h = value
    print(k,l,h)



k,l,h>>>>1,4,7
k,l,h>>>>2,5,8
k,l,h>>>>3,6,9

 

zip函数

原文:https://www.cnblogs.com/chenweitao/p/12546301.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!